超超临界锅炉过热器连通管焊接接头开裂原因分析与处理

Analysis and treatment of welding joint cracking of ultra supercritical boiler superheater pipe

摘要

Abstract

In view of welding process,joint condition,crack shape,and facility structure,analyzes the causes for cracking of weld joints of connecting pipes from low-temperature superheater to pendant superheater at a power plant in operation.The results show that weld joints are exposed to stress concentration with coarse HAZ grains while various stresses overlap to create peak stress within the sensitive temperature of reheat cracking.Thus,the peak stress leads to loosening stress and results in cracking.To avoid such problems,a few effective repair procedures and preventive countermeasures are proposed,providing reference for enterprises to prevent and control similar problems.

Key words

12Cr1MoVG steel/reheat cracking/connecting pipes/superheater
